Wherever would be the Hull ID Selection located?
The Hull Identification Quantity (HIN) is often a 12- or 14-character serial amount that uniquely identifies a boat. The HIN is analogous to a VIN on an automobile.
All boats produced or imported on or immediately after November 1, 1972, have to bear a HIN, and this HIN need to be determined for the duration of boat registration. Vessels made or imported right before 1972 are EXEMPT because they normally do not have a HIN.
The HIN is uncovered over a metal or plastic plate, usually within the transom of the boat, ordinarily on the appropriate starboard (suitable) facet of the transom within just two inches of the highest of transom, gunwale, or hull/deck joint, whichever is least expensive.
On vessels without having transoms, or impractical to use transoms, the HIN will likely be affixed on the starboard (proper) outboard aspect of hull, aft, within just a single foot on the stern and inside of two inches of the very best of your hull side, gunwale or hull/deck joint, whichever is least expensive.
On catamarans and pontoon boats with replaceable hulls, the HIN is frequently affixed to your aft crossbeam, in just a single foot with the starboard (appropriate) hull attachment.
On home made vessels, there are actually circumstances wherever Every point out plus the U.S. Coast Guard will assign hull quantities straight to an applicant. Point out issued hull figures will begin with their regular registration prefix followed by the letter “Z”. Coastline Guard issued hull identification numbers are prefixed by “USZ”.
On US Coast Guard Documented Vessels, the Hull Identification Number is displayed on the very best of your CG-1270 Certification of Documentation beside the Vessel Formal Number
The Code of Federal Laws CFR Title forty six Portion sixty seven regulates Hull Identification Figures as a result:
§ 181.23 Hull identification figures required.
(a) A company will have to recognize Each individual boat developed or imported with Most important and secondary hull identification numbers completely affixed in accordance with § 181.29 of this subpart.
(b) A individual who manufactures or imports a boat for his / her own use and not on the market ought to receive the needed hull identification quantity in accordance with the necessities from the issuing authority detailed in 33 CFR element 173, Appendix A with the boat‘s Point out of principal operation and forever affix the HIN to the boat in accordance with § 181.29 of this subpart.
(c) No man or woman might assign the identical HIN to more than one boat.
§ 181.29 Hull identification number display.
Two similar hull identification quantities are needed to be displayed on Every boat hull.
(a) The key hull identification selection has to be affixed –
(1) On boats with transoms, into the starboard outboard facet of the transom inside of two inches of the highest with the transom, gunwale, or hull/deck joint, whichever is cheapest.
(2) On boats devoid of transoms or on boats on which It could be impractical to make use of the transom, towards the starboard outboard side in the hull, aft, in 1 foot in the stern and inside of two inches of the very best in the hull facet, gunwale or hull/deck joint, whichever is cheapest.
(3) vessel registration lookup On catamarans and pontoon boats that have conveniently replaceable hulls, on the aft crossbeam in just a person foot of the starboard hull attachment.
(four) When the hull identification number wouldn't be visible, due to rails, fittings, or other equipment, the selection should be affixed as in the vicinity of as you possibly can to The situation specified in paragraph (a) of the part.
(b) The replicate hull identification range have to be affixed within an unexposed site on the interior with the boat or beneath a fitting or item of components.
(c) Each individual hull identification range has to be carved, burned, stamped, embossed, molded, bonded, or otherwise permanently affixed into the boat to ensure alteration, removing, or replacement could be evident. Should the range is with a independent plate, the plate has to be fastened in this kind of method that its elimination would normally lead to some scarring of or damage to the surrounding hull location. A hull identification number will have to not be attached to parts of the boat which might be detachable.
(d) The figures of each hull identification selection needs to be no under a person-fourth of the inch large.
